Galaxy Digital has demonstrated early institutional interest by committing $10 million to WisdomTree’s Government Money Market Digital Fund, highlighting the increasing demand for tokenized investments among major players, the report noted. This development also signals growing rivalry among asset managers to bring regulated investment products onto the blockchain. According to the report, Franklin Templeton and BlackRock are also exploring blockchain to improve distribution and liquidity for institutional investors. WisdomTree’s multi-chain approach reflects a wider industry movement, as firms strive to innovate while remaining compliant in the changing RWA sector.
